After all, the area was first a development project and has since become a gated community with resort-style amenities. In fact, Hot Springs Village is one of the largest gated communities in the United States, with a population of 12,807 at the 2010 census.

In terms of race, the hot Springs Village area has a majority of White residents (96.5%), and only a small proportion of African-American and Hispanic residents. The median household and family income in Hot Springs Village City was $41,875, with males earning $35,236 and females earning $20,313. The per capita income in the CDP was $24,492, making it a relatively affluent community. However, it is important to note that only 1.6% of households and 2.5% of individuals were living below the federal poverty level. Additionally, 18.4% of households had a single elderly person living alone.
